Financial Wellness Program Performance Metrics
Similarly measuring the effectiveness of your Financial Wellness Program strategies requires clear performance metrics. Key indicators include return on investment, savings rate, debt-to-income ratio, and net worth growth. By tracking these metrics consistently, you can identify which financial health are working and where adjustments are needed.
- ROI Tracking: Monitor returns on your Financial Wellness Program investments to ensure they meet your targets
- Savings Rate: Aim to save at least 20% of your income as part of your Financial Wellness Program plan
- Debt Management: Keep your debt-to-income ratio below 36% for optimal Financial Wellness Program health
- Net Worth Growth: Track your net worth quarterly to measure financial health effectiveness

Common Financial Wellness Program Mistakes to Avoid
Accordingly even experienced individuals make mistakes when it comes to Financial Wellness Program. Recognizing these common pitfalls can save you significant time and money. Studies from Consumer Financial Protection Bureau show that avoiding these errors can improve financial outcomes by a substantial margin. Here are the most frequent Financial Wellness Program mistakes and how to steer clear of them.
- Procrastination: Delaying your Financial Wellness Program plan reduces the power of compounding and limits your long-term growth potential
- Lack of Diversification: Putting all your resources into a single approach exposes your Financial Wellness Program strategy to unnecessary risk
- Ignoring Fees: High fees can erode your Financial Wellness Program returns over time, so always evaluate the cost structure of financial products
- Emotional Decisions: Making financial health based on fear or greed rather than analysis leads to poor outcomes
- No Emergency Fund: Without a safety net, unexpected expenses can derail your entire Financial Wellness Program plan
Similarly avoiding these mistakes requires discipline and a commitment to following your Financial Wellness Program strategy even when temptations arise. Regular reviews of your financial plan help you stay on course and make necessary adjustments before small issues become major problems.
